Buying Land to Build a Cottage Village in Israel: A Comprehensive Guide

If you are considering investing in real estate in Israel and have a vision of creating a gated community, buying land is a crucial step in making your dream a reality. Here is a detailed guide to guide you through the process of acquiring land for a gated community in Israel:

Determine the scope of your project: Start by determining the scope of your cottage community project. Consider factors such as the number of cottages you intend to build, the desired size of the settlement, and the amenities and infrastructure you plan to provide. This will help you estimate the land requirements for your project.

Identify Suitable Locations: Explore the various regions of Israel to determine suitable locations for your cottage community. Consider factors such as proximity to amenities, accessibility to transportation networks, natural surroundings, and potential market demand. Consult real estate professionals who specialize in land sales to get an idea of ​​the market and identify promising areas.

Contact a real estate agent: It is highly recommended to work with a reputable real estate agent who has experience in land sales and development projects. An agent can assist you in finding suitable land options, negotiating prices and familiarizing yourself with the legal and regulatory aspects of purchasing land in Israel.

Perform due diligence: Conduct a thorough due diligence before completing your land purchase. This includes assessing the legal status of the land, verifying ownership, and investigating any potential encumbrances or restrictions that may affect your development plans. Get a qualified lawyer to help you with these checks.

Consult Local Authorities: Engage in discussions with the relevant local authorities and municipality to understand zoning regulations, planning requirements, and any specific recommendations for cottage communities in the desired location. This will help ensure that your project complies with local policies and development guidelines.

Evaluate the infrastructure and utilities: Assess the availability of the necessary infrastructure and utilities in the area where you intend to establish a gated community. Consider factors such as water supply, electricity, sewer systems and access roads. If these utilities are not available, look into the possibility and cost of connecting to them.

Consider environmental factors: Consider the environmental impact of your project. Assess factors such as environmental sensitivity, protected areas, and any potential environmental restrictions or regulations that may apply. Ensure compliance with environmental standards and obtain necessary permits.

Financial considerations: Determine your budget and secure the necessary funding for land acquisition and subsequent development activities. Consult with financial institutions and professionals to explore financing options specific to real estate development projects.

Purchase Negotiations: Enter into negotiations with the landowner or his representative to reach a mutually acceptable price and terms of purchase. Work closely with your real estate agent and legal advisor to ensure that all legal and contractual aspects are properly considered.

Complete your purchase: After reaching an agreement, complete your purchase by signing the required legal documents and making the required payments. Make sure you follow all legal procedures, including registering your land.

Develop your cottage community: Once you have secured the land, start the process of designing and building your cottage community. Engage architects, engineers, and contractors to help bring your vision to life. Adhere to local building codes and ensure quality construction practices throughout the development process.

Sell your cottages: Once your cottage community is complete, develop a marketing strategy to attract potential buyers. Use a variety of marketing channels including online platforms, real estate agencies and targeted advertising to showcase the unique features and benefits of your cottages.

Purchasing a plot of land to build a gated community in Israel requires careful planning, research and collaboration with real estate industry professionals. By following these steps and gaining the necessary experience, you will be able to successfully complete the process of buying land and start developing your dream cottage community in Israel.
